Chandigarh , 12 Dec 2012

Punjab Pradesh Congress Committee President Capt Amarinder Singh today questioned the rationale and intent of the Deputy Chief Minister Sukhbir Singh Badal in setting up a grievances office at the state police headquarters.“It either reflects the DyCM’s lack of confidence in himself or his own Director General of Police”, he remarked, while at the same time asking who will allow a common man access to the fortified police headquarters in Chandigarh. The grievance cell should be in each police station, he observed.Reacting to the development, Capt Amarinder said, it was surprising and unprecedented that the Deputy Chief Minister who is also the Home Minister of the state felt the need of setting up his grievance redressal office at the police headquarters next to the office of the Director General of Police.The former Chief Minister maintained that this was quite against the established protocol that the Deputy Chief Minister had to go to the police headquarters for setting up the grievance redressal office.“It raises questions whether the will of the DyCM is prevailing in the police or not”, he observed, while adding, otherwise why would a Home Minister need to himself go the police headquarters and not summon the DGP to his office.He said, it was quite unprecedented development in the history of the state that a Deputy Chief Minister who is also the Home Minister had to set up his “Centre for Public Complaints” in DGP’s office.Capt Amarinder said, setting up of this centre or launching a web portal or toll free number was not going to solve the problem of law and order in the state as long as the Akali Jathedars do not rule the police stations.

“It is a strange coincidence that while the Akali goons and members of the Bikram Sena are sitting in the police stations, the DyCM will start sitting at the police headquarters the same way in the name of his complaints centre”, he remarked while having a dig at Sukhbir.
